那些你可能不知道的OCR图片文字识别工具:小众但强大的技术利器
2025.09.19 19:05浏览量:61简介:本文深入探讨五款小众OCR工具,涵盖开源框架、垂直领域工具及云服务API,从技术实现到应用场景详细解析,为开发者提供高性价比的OCR解决方案。
引言:OCR技术的隐藏版图
在主流OCR工具(如Tesseract、Adobe Acrobat)占据市场的背景下,许多开发者可能忽略了更垂直、更高效的替代方案。这些”你可能不知道的OCR工具”往往针对特定场景优化,具备独特的算法优势或成本效益。本文将揭示五类小众OCR工具,从开源框架到垂直领域解决方案,帮助开发者找到最适合的技术路径。
一、开源领域的”黑马”:PaddleOCR与EasyOCR
1. PaddleOCR:百度开源的中文优化方案
作为百度PaddlePaddle生态的一部分,PaddleOCR在中文识别场景中表现突出。其核心优势包括:
- 多语言支持:内置中英文混合识别模型,支持134种语言
- 轻量化设计:PP-OCRv3模型仅3.5M参数量,适合移动端部署
- 场景适配:提供表格识别、版面分析等垂直功能
技术实现示例:
from paddleocr import PaddleOCRocr = PaddleOCR(use_angle_cls=True, lang="ch") # 中文识别result = ocr.ocr("test.jpg", cls=True)for line in result:print(line[1][0]) # 输出识别文本
2. EasyOCR:跨语言识别的极简方案
基于PyTorch的EasyOCR支持80+种语言,其特点包括:
- 零配置使用:
pip install easyocr后单行代码调用 - GPU加速:自动检测CUDA环境
- 动态模型加载:按需下载语言包
性能对比:
| 工具 | 准确率(英文) | 速度(FPS) | 内存占用 |
|——————|————————|——————-|—————|
| EasyOCR | 92.3% | 18 | 450MB |
| Tesseract | 89.7% | 12 | 320MB |
二、垂直领域的”专家”:文档与手写体OCR
1. DocTr:文档结构还原工具
针对扫描文档的OCR需求,DocTr不仅能识别文字,还能还原:
- 版面分析:区分标题、正文、表格区域
- 公式识别:支持LaTeX格式输出
- 双栏检测:自动处理学术期刊的复杂布局
应用场景:
- 法律文书数字化
- 学术论文结构化
- 财务报表提取
2. Handwriting-OCR:手写体识别突破
传统OCR在手写场景准确率不足60%,而专用工具如:
- IAM Dataset训练模型:针对英文手写优化
- 中文手写库:CASIA-HWDB数据集支持
- 实时识别API:如MyScript的Nebo应用
技术挑战:
- 连笔字处理
- 不同书写风格适应
- 低质量扫描件增强
三、云服务的”隐藏选项”:小众API服务
1. Aspose.OCR:企业级文档处理
提供比主流云服务更灵活的定价模式:
- 按页计费:0.003美元/页起
- 私有化部署:支持Docker容器化
- PDF/A合规:满足档案存储标准
API调用示例:
// Java SDK示例OcrApi api = new OcrApi("api_key");OcrResponse response = api.RecognizeArea("image.jpg",new Rectangle(100, 100, 200, 50));System.out.println(response.getText());
2. Rossum.ai:发票自动化专家
针对财务文档的OCR解决方案:
- 字段级提取:自动识别发票号、金额等
- 上下文校验:通过AI验证数据合理性
- ERP集成:直接输出XML到SAP/Oracle
ROI分析:
某跨国企业部署后,财务处理效率提升70%,错误率下降92%。
四、硬件加速的”新势力”:边缘计算OCR
1. NVIDIA DeepStream:GPU加速方案
利用TensorRT优化的OCR流水线:
- 实时处理:4K视频流达25FPS
- 多模型并行:同时运行检测、识别、跟踪
- 低延迟:端到端延迟<100ms
架构示例:
摄像头 → DeepStream → OCR模型 → 结构化输出 → 数据库
2. 树莓派专用方案:OpenMV与H7摄像头
低成本边缘OCR实现:
- 硬件成本:<50美元
- 识别速度:3FPS(QVGA分辨率)
- 离线运行:无需网络连接
典型应用:
- 工业产线计数
- 智能货架管理
- 无人零售结算
五、选择工具的决策框架
1. 评估维度矩阵
| 维度 | 开源工具 | 云API | 边缘方案 |
|---|---|---|---|
| 初始成本 | 低 | 中 | 中高 |
| 维护复杂度 | 高 | 低 | 中 |
| 隐私控制 | 完全 | 部分 | 完全 |
| 扩展性 | 中 | 高 | 低 |
2. 场景化推荐
- 高精度需求:PaddleOCR + 自定义训练
- 快速集成:EasyOCR或Aspose API
- 隐私敏感:边缘计算方案
- 复杂文档:DocTr + 人工校验
结论:超越主流的选择
这些”你可能不知道的OCR工具”证明,技术选型不应局限于市场知名度。通过评估具体场景的需求(如语言种类、处理速度、部署环境),开发者可以发现更高效、更经济的解决方案。建议从开源工具入手,逐步过渡到云服务或边缘方案,构建符合业务需求的OCR技术栈。
行动建议:
- 先用EasyOCR快速验证需求
- 复杂场景测试PaddleOCR的中文模型
- 隐私要求高时评估树莓派方案
- 企业级需求联系Aspose获取定制报价
在OCR技术持续进化的今天,保持对小众工具的关注,往往能带来意想不到的效率提升。

发表评论
登录后可评论,请前往 登录 或 注册